Tobiko is a type of caviar made from the eggs of flying fish. These eggs offer a crunchy texture and a robust flavour.
- Flying fish, which is the primary source of tobiko, can be found in temperate and tropical oceans all over the world.
- Tobiko is a popular sushi and sashimi garnish that adds texture and colour to the dish.
